Donna's Deli

3 Firs Lane, Leigh WN74SA ,United Kingdom
Donna's Deli Donna's Deli is one of the popular Cafe located in 3 Firs Lane , listed under Sandwich Shop in Leigh , Food/grocery in Leigh ,

Contact Details & Working Hours

Map of Donna's Deli